How is a fence engineered to survive high winds here?
The 115 MPH V-ult wind speed rating dictates the design. This requires closer post spacing, deeper concrete footings below the frost line, and ASCE 7-22-compliant wind load calculations on the solid face area. Proper bracket strength and rail connections are critical to resist peak storm season gusts without collapse.

Why do fences in Belchertown Center fail, and how deep should posts go?
Posts fail due to frost heave. The design frost depth is 48 inches. IRC Section R403.1.4 requires footings to extend below this line. Posts set shallower will lift and rack during freeze-thaw cycles, compromising structural integrity for the 115 MPH V-ult wind rating.
How do Belchertown's soil and pest conditions affect material choice?
Moderate soil corrosivity and termite risk require compatible materials. Pressure-treated pine must be rated for ground contact. Use hot-dip galvanized or stainless steel fasteners to prevent rust streaks. Avoid untreated wood in direct soil contact and consider metal posts in high-moisture zones.
What is required before any excavation for a fence?
You must contact Massachusetts Dig Safe at 811. They mark public utility lines. Hitting a gas or fiber line in Belchertown Center causes major liability, service disruption, and fines. How do modern gate systems meet pool safety and security needs?
Pool barriers must comply with 780 CMR 115.AA, requiring self-closing, self-latching gates at least 48 inches high. Integrating IoT smart latches provides remote status alerts and meets this code. This dual function addresses liability by proving a 'duty of care' for Massachusetts homeowners.
What are the fence height and placement rules for my lot?
Zoning limits are 4 feet in front yards and 6 feet in rear yards. The setback is 0 feet, allowing installation on the property line. A critical rule for corner lots is maintaining the 'sight triangle' for driver visibility, especially near US Route 202. The front yard limit applies to all sides facing a street.
